CIBC Mellon is seeking a Derivatives Analyst in Toronto to develop accounting solutions for new derivative products and to provide post-implementation staff training and oversight. This role emphasizes automation and process improvement within the Derivatives Operations team, supporting the Supervisor and Manager on complex inquiries.
Ideal candidates bring strong derivative knowledge, CMS/IAS experience, and at least 3 years in securities operations.
CIBC Mellon is a leading provider of asset servicing solutions to institutional investors in Canada, including multi-currency accounting, fund valuation, and investment information reporting. The Derivatives Analyst, Derivatives Operations, will develop accounting solutions in the Derivatives Operations team for new derivative products and to provide post-implementation staff training and oversight on the new procedures. Initiates process improvement with a focus on automation of processes within the Derivatives Operations team. Will also act as a resource to the Supervisor and Manager in finding solutions to more complex client inquiries.
